CMS 3D CMS Logo

DreamSD Member List

This is the complete list of members for DreamSD, including all inherited members.

AssignSD(const std::string &vname)SensitiveDetectorprivate
birk1_DreamSDprivate
birk2_DreamSDprivate
birk3_DreamSDprivate
CaloSD(const std::string &aSDname, const edm::EventSetup &es, const SensitiveDetectorCatalog &clg, edm::ParameterSet const &p, const SimTrackManager *, float timeSlice=1., bool ignoreTkID=false)CaloSD
chAngleIntegrals_DreamSDprivate
checkHit()CaloSDprotected
cherenkovDeposit_(const G4Step *aStep)DreamSDprivate
cleanHitCollection()CaloSDprivate
cleanIndexCaloSDprivate
clear() overrideCaloSD
clearHits() overrideCaloSDvirtual
cmsTrackInformation(const G4Track *aTrack)SensitiveDetectorprotected
ConvertToLocal3DPoint(const G4ThreeVector &point) constSensitiveDetectorinlineprotected
coordinates enum nameSensitiveDetectorprotected
correctTCaloSDprivate
corrTOFBeamCaloSDprivate
createNewHit(const G4Step *, const G4Track *)CaloSDprotected
crystalLength(G4LogicalVolume *) constDreamSDprivate
crystalWidth(G4LogicalVolume *) constDreamSDprivate
currentHitCaloSDprotected
currentIDCaloSDprotected
curve_LY(const G4Step *, int)DreamSDprivate
dd4hep_DreamSDprivate
DimensionMap typedefDreamSDprivate
doCherenkov_DreamSDprivate
doFineCalo_CaloSDprivate
Doubles typedefDreamSDprivate
DrawAll() overrideCaloSD
DreamSD(const std::string &, const edm::EventSetup &, const SensitiveDetectorCatalog &, edm::ParameterSet const &, const SimTrackManager *)DreamSD
edepositEMCaloSDprotected
edepositHADCaloSDprotected
eMinFine_CaloSDprivate
eminHitCaloSDprotected
eminHitDCaloSDprivate
endEvent()CaloSDprotectedvirtual
EndOfEvent(G4HCofThisEvent *eventHC) overrideCaloSD
EnergyCorrected(const G4Step &step, const G4Track *)CaloSDprotectedvirtual
energyCutCaloSDprotected
entranceLocalCaloSDprotected
entrancePointCaloSDprotected
fillHits(edm::PCaloHitContainer &, const std::string &) overrideCaloSDvirtual
fillMap(const std::string &, double, double)DreamSDprivate
filterHit(CaloG4Hit *, double)CaloSDprotectedvirtual
FinalStepPosition(const G4Step *step, coordinates) constSensitiveDetectorprotected
fineDetectors_CaloSDprivate
forceSaveCaloSDprotected
getAttenuation(const G4Step *aStep, double birk1, double birk2, double birk3) constCaloSDprotected
getAverageNumberOfPhotons_(const double charge, const double beta, const G4Material *aMaterial, const G4MaterialPropertyVector *rIndex)DreamSDprivate
getDepth(const G4Step *)CaloSDprotectedvirtual
getEnergyDeposit(const G4Step *) overrideDreamSDprotectedvirtual
getFromLibrary(const G4Step *step)CaloSDprotectedvirtual
getNames() constSensitiveDetectorinline
getNumberOfHits()CaloSDprotected
getPhotonEnergyDeposit_(const G4ParticleMomentum &p, const G4ThreeVector &x, const G4Step *aStep)DreamSDprivate
getResponseWt(const G4Track *)CaloSDprotected
getTrackID(const G4Track *)CaloSDprotectedvirtual
hcIDCaloSDprivate
hitBookkeepingFineCalo(const G4Step *step, const G4Track *currentTrack, CaloG4Hit *hit)CaloSDprotected
hitExists(const G4Step *)CaloSDprotected
hitMapCaloSDprivate
ignoreRejectCaloSDprivate
ignoreRejection()CaloSDinlineprotected
ignoreTrackIDCaloSDprivate
incidentEnergyCaloSDprotected
initEvent(const BeginOfEvent *)CaloSDprotectedvirtual
Initialize(G4HCofThisEvent *HCE) overrideCaloSD
InitialStepPosition(const G4Step *step, coordinates) constSensitiveDetectorprotected
initMap(const std::string &, const edm::EventSetup &)DreamSDprivate
initRun() overrideDreamSDprotectedvirtual
isCaloSD() constSensitiveDetectorinline
isItFineCalo(const G4VTouchable *touch)CaloSD
isParameterizedCaloSDprivate
k_ScaleFromDD4HepToG4DreamSDprivatestatic
k_ScaleFromDDDToG4DreamSDprivatestatic
kmaxIonCaloSDprotected
kmaxNeutronCaloSDprotected
kmaxProtonCaloSDprotected
LocalCoordinates enum valueSensitiveDetectorprotected
LocalPostStepPosition(const G4Step *step) constSensitiveDetectorprotected
LocalPreStepPosition(const G4Step *step) constSensitiveDetectorprotected
m_isCaloSensitiveDetectorprivate
m_namesOfSDSensitiveDetectorprivate
m_trackManagerCaloSDprivate
materialPropertiesTable_DreamSDprivate
meanResponseCaloSDprivate
NaNTrap(const G4Step *step) constSensitiveDetectorprotected
nCheckedHitsCaloSDprivate
nphotons_DreamSDprivate
Observer< const BeginOfRun * >::Observer()Observer< const BeginOfRun * >inline
Observer< const BeginOfEvent * >::Observer()Observer< const BeginOfEvent * >inline
Observer< const BeginOfTrack * >::Observer()Observer< const BeginOfTrack * >inline
Observer< const EndOfTrack * >::Observer()Observer< const EndOfTrack * >inline
Observer< const EndOfEvent * >::Observer()Observer< const EndOfEvent * >inline
posGlobalCaloSDprotected
previousIDCaloSDprotected
primAncestorCaloSDprivate
primIDSavedCaloSDprivate
printableDecayChain(const std::vector< unsigned int > &decayChain)CaloSDprotectedstatic
PrintAll() overrideCaloSD
printDetectorLevels(const G4VTouchable *) constCaloSDprotected
processHit(const G4Step *step)CaloSDinlineprotected
ProcessHits(G4Step *step, G4TouchableHistory *) overrideCaloSDvirtual
ProcessHits(G4GFlashSpot *aSpot, G4TouchableHistory *) overrideCaloSD
readBothSide_DreamSDprivate
reset() overrideCaloSDvirtual
resetForNewPrimary(const G4Step *)CaloSDprotected
reusehitCaloSDprivate
saveHit(CaloG4Hit *)CaloSDprivate
SensitiveCaloDetector(const std::string &iname, const edm::EventSetup &es, const SensitiveDetectorCatalog &clg, edm::ParameterSet const &p)SensitiveCaloDetectorinlineexplicit
SensitiveDetector(const std::string &iname, const edm::EventSetup &es, const SensitiveDetectorCatalog &, edm::ParameterSet const &p, bool calo)SensitiveDetectorexplicit
setDetUnitId(const G4Step *) overrideDreamSDvirtual
setNames(const std::vector< std::string > &)SensitiveDetectorprotected
setNumberCheckedHits(int val)CaloSDinlineprotected
setParameterized(bool val)CaloSDinlineprotected
setPbWO2MaterialProperties_(G4Material *aMaterial)DreamSDprivate
setToGlobal(const G4ThreeVector &, const G4VTouchable *) constCaloSDprotected
setToLocal(const G4ThreeVector &, const G4VTouchable *) constCaloSDprotected
setTrackID(const G4Step *)CaloSDprotectedvirtual
setUseMap(bool val)CaloSDinlineprotected
side_DreamSDprivate
slaveCaloSDprivate
slopeLY_DreamSDprivate
Observer< const BeginOfRun * >::slotForUpdate(const BeginOfRun * iT)Observer< const BeginOfRun * >inline
Observer< const BeginOfEvent * >::slotForUpdate(const BeginOfEvent * iT)Observer< const BeginOfEvent * >inline
Observer< const BeginOfTrack * >::slotForUpdate(const BeginOfTrack * iT)Observer< const BeginOfTrack * >inline
Observer< const EndOfTrack * >::slotForUpdate(const EndOfTrack * iT)Observer< const EndOfTrack * >inline
Observer< const EndOfEvent * >::slotForUpdate(const EndOfEvent * iT)Observer< const EndOfEvent * >inline
storeHit(CaloG4Hit *)CaloSDprivate
suppressHeavyCaloSDprotected
theHCCaloSDprivate
timeSliceCaloSDprivate
tkMapCaloSDprivate
tmaxHitCaloSDprotected
totalHitsCaloSDprivate
update(const BeginOfRun *) overrideCaloSDprotectedvirtual
update(const BeginOfEvent *) overrideCaloSDprotectedvirtual
update(const BeginOfTrack *trk) overrideCaloSDprotectedvirtual
update(const EndOfTrack *trk) overrideCaloSDprotectedvirtual
update(const ::EndOfEvent *) overrideCaloSDprotected
Observer< const EndOfEvent * >::update(const EndOfEvent *)=0Observer< const EndOfEvent * >protectedpure virtual
updateHit(CaloG4Hit *)CaloSDprotected
useBirk_DreamSDprivate
useMapCaloSDprivate
WorldCoordinates enum valueSensitiveDetectorprotected
xtalLMap_DreamSDprivate
~CaloSD() overrideCaloSD
~DreamSD() overrideDreamSDinline
Observer< const BeginOfRun * >::~Observer()Observer< const BeginOfRun * >inlinevirtual
Observer< const BeginOfEvent * >::~Observer()Observer< const BeginOfEvent * >inlinevirtual
Observer< const BeginOfTrack * >::~Observer()Observer< const BeginOfTrack * >inlinevirtual
Observer< const EndOfTrack * >::~Observer()Observer< const EndOfTrack * >inlinevirtual
Observer< const EndOfEvent * >::~Observer()Observer< const EndOfEvent * >inlinevirtual
~SensitiveDetector() overrideSensitiveDetector